com.jp.protection.pub.launch
Class ProtectionLauncherConfigBase

java.lang.Object
  extended by com.jp.protection.pub.launch.ProtectionLauncherConfigBase
All Implemented Interfaces:
java.io.Serializable, java.lang.Cloneable
Direct Known Subclasses:
ProtectionLauncherConfig

public class ProtectionLauncherConfigBase
extends java.lang.Object
implements java.io.Serializable, java.lang.Cloneable

See Also:
Serialized Form

Field Summary
protected  boolean fAcceptLicenseAgreement
           
protected  int fActivationLockOptions
           
protected  java.lang.String fActivationWizardLogo
           
protected  java.lang.String fActivationWizardLogoRes
           
protected  int fActivationWizardOptions
           
protected  boolean fAllowFlexibleExpirationDate
           
protected  boolean fCheckPreviousShutdownDate
           
protected  java.lang.String fCompany
           
protected  java.lang.String fCompanyLogo
           
protected  java.lang.String fCompanyLogoRes
           
protected  java.lang.String fCopyright
           
protected  java.lang.String fDeactivationWizardLogo
           
protected  java.lang.String fDeactivationWizardLogoRes
           
protected  int fDeactivationWizardOptions
           
protected  FacadeConnectionConfig[] fFacadeConnectionConfigs
           
protected  boolean fGUI
           
protected  java.lang.String fLicenseFileName
           
protected  java.lang.String fLicenseFolder
           
protected  java.lang.String fLicenseLockWizardLogo
           
protected  java.lang.String fLicenseLockWizardLogoRes
           
protected  int fLicenseLockWizardOptions
           
protected  java.lang.String fLicenseResourceFolder
           
protected  java.lang.String fLicenseTextCommercial
           
protected  java.lang.String fLicenseTextCommercialRes
           
protected  java.lang.String fLicenseTextEvaluation
           
protected  java.lang.String fLicenseTextEvaluationRes
           
protected  boolean fLicenseUserHomeRelative
           
protected  LicensingServerConnectionConfig[] fLicensingServerConnectionConfigs
           
protected  java.lang.String fLicensingServerStatusURL
           
protected  java.lang.String fLicensingWizardLogo
           
protected  java.lang.String fLicensingWizardLogoRes
           
protected  int fLicensingWizardOptions
           
protected  boolean fMaintainPreviousShutdownDate
           
protected  java.util.List<LicenseLocation> fPrevLicenseLocations
           
protected  SecretStorage.Provider[] fSecretStorageProviders
           
protected  boolean fSilentActivation
           
protected  boolean fUseStrippedActivationKeyChars
           
static long serialVersionUID
           
 
Constructor Summary
ProtectionLauncherConfigBase()
           
 
Method Summary
 java.lang.Object clone()
           
 int getActivationLockOptions()
           
 java.lang.String getActivationLockOptionsStr()
           
 java.lang.String getActivationWizardLogo()
           
 java.lang.String getActivationWizardLogoRes()
           
 int getActivationWizardOptions()
           
 java.lang.String getActivationWizardOptionsStr()
           
 java.lang.String getCompany()
           
 java.lang.String getCompanyLogo()
           
 java.lang.String getCompanyLogoRes()
           
 java.lang.String getCopyright()
           
 java.lang.String getDeactivationWizardLogo()
           
 java.lang.String getDeactivationWizardLogoRes()
           
 int getDeactivationWizardOptions()
           
 java.lang.String getDeactivationWizardOptionsStr()
           
 FacadeConnectionConfig[] getFacadeConnectionConfigs()
           
 java.lang.String getLicenseFileName()
           
 java.lang.String getLicenseFolder()
           
 java.lang.String getLicenseLockWizardLogo()
           
 java.lang.String getLicenseLockWizardLogoRes()
           
 int getLicenseLockWizardOptions()
           
 java.lang.String getLicenseLockWizardOptionsStr()
           
 java.lang.String getLicenseResourceFolder()
           
 java.lang.String getLicenseTextCommercial()
           
 java.lang.String getLicenseTextCommercialRes()
           
 java.lang.String getLicenseTextEvaluation()
           
 java.lang.String getLicenseTextEvaluationRes()
           
 LicensingServerConnectionConfig[] getLicensingServerConnectionConfigs()
           
 java.lang.String getLicensingServerStatusURL()
           
 java.lang.String getLicensingWizardLogo()
           
 java.lang.String getLicensingWizardLogoRes()
           
 int getLicensingWizardOptions()
           
 java.lang.String getLicensingWizardOptionsStr()
           
 java.util.List<LicenseLocation> getPrevLicenseLocations()
           
 SecretStorage.Provider[] getSecretStorageProviders()
           
 boolean isAcceptLicenseAgreement()
           
 boolean isAllowFlexibleExpirationDate()
           
 boolean isCheckPreviousShutdownDate()
           
 boolean isGUI()
           
 boolean isLicenseUserHomeRelative()
           
 boolean isMaintainPreviousShutdownDate()
           
 boolean isSilentActivation()
           
 boolean isUseStrippedActivationKeyChars()
           
 void setAcceptLicenseAgreement(boolean aAcceptLicenseAgreement)
           
 void setActivationLockOptions(int aActivationLockOptions)
           
 void setActivationWizardLogo(java.lang.String aActivationWizardLogo)
           
 void setActivationWizardLogoRes(java.lang.String aActivationWizardLogoRes)
           
 void setActivationWizardOptions(int aActivationWizardOptions)
           
 void setAllowFlexibleExpirationDate(boolean aAllowFlexibleExpirationDate)
           
 void setCheckPreviousShutdownDate(boolean aCheckPreviousShutdownDate)
           
 void setCompany(java.lang.String aCompany)
           
 void setCompanyLogo(java.lang.String aCompanyLogo)
           
 void setCompanyLogoRes(java.lang.String aCompanyLogoRes)
           
 void setCopyright(java.lang.String aCopyright)
           
 void setDeactivationWizardLogo(java.lang.String aDeactivationWizardLogo)
           
 void setDeactivationWizardLogoRes(java.lang.String aDeactivationWizardLogoRes)
           
 void setDeactivationWizardOptions(int aDeactivationWizardOptions)
           
 void setFacadeConnectionConfigs(FacadeConnectionConfig[] aFacadeConnectionConfigs)
           
 void setGUI(boolean aGUI)
           
 void setLicenseFileName(java.lang.String aLicenseFileName)
           
 void setLicenseFolder(java.lang.String aLicenseFolder)
           
 void setLicenseLockWizardLogo(java.lang.String aLicenseLockWizardLogo)
           
 void setLicenseLockWizardLogoRes(java.lang.String aLicenseLockWizardLogoRes)
           
 void setLicenseLockWizardOptions(int aLicenseLockWizardOptions)
           
 void setLicenseResourceFolder(java.lang.String aLicenseResourceFolder)
           
 void setLicenseTextCommercial(java.lang.String aLicenseTextCommercial)
           
 void setLicenseTextCommercialRes(java.lang.String aLicenseTextCommercialRes)
           
 void setLicenseTextEvaluation(java.lang.String aLicenseTextEvaluation)
           
 void setLicenseTextEvaluationRes(java.lang.String aLicenseTextEvaluationRes)
           
 void setLicenseUserHomeRelative(boolean aLicenseUserHomeRelative)
           
 void setLicensingServerConnectionConfigs(LicensingServerConnectionConfig[] aLicensingServerConnectionConfigs)
           
 void setLicensingServerStatusURL(java.lang.String aLicensingServerStatusURL)
           
 void setLicensingWizardLogo(java.lang.String aLicensingWizardLogo)
           
 void setLicensingWizardLogoRes(java.lang.String aLicensingWizardLogoRes)
           
 void setLicensingWizardOptions(int anOptions)
           
 void setMaintainPreviousShutdownDate(boolean aMaintainPreviousShutdownDate)
           
 void setSecretStorageProviders(SecretStorage.Provider[] aSecretStorageProviders)
           
 void setSilentActivation(boolean aSilentActivation)
           
 void setUseStrippedActivationKeyChars(boolean aUseStrippedActivationKeyChars)
           
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

serialVersionUID

public static final long serialVersionUID
See Also:
Constant Field Values

fLicensingServerStatusURL

protected java.lang.String fLicensingServerStatusURL

fPrevLicenseLocations

protected java.util.List<LicenseLocation> fPrevLicenseLocations

fCopyright

protected java.lang.String fCopyright

fCompany

protected java.lang.String fCompany

fCompanyLogo

protected java.lang.String fCompanyLogo

fCompanyLogoRes

protected java.lang.String fCompanyLogoRes

fLicenseFileName

protected java.lang.String fLicenseFileName

fLicenseFolder

protected java.lang.String fLicenseFolder

fLicenseUserHomeRelative

protected boolean fLicenseUserHomeRelative

fLicenseResourceFolder

protected java.lang.String fLicenseResourceFolder

fLicenseTextCommercial

protected java.lang.String fLicenseTextCommercial

fLicenseTextCommercialRes

protected java.lang.String fLicenseTextCommercialRes

fLicenseTextEvaluation

protected java.lang.String fLicenseTextEvaluation

fLicenseTextEvaluationRes

protected java.lang.String fLicenseTextEvaluationRes

fGUI

protected boolean fGUI

fAllowFlexibleExpirationDate

protected boolean fAllowFlexibleExpirationDate

fCheckPreviousShutdownDate

protected boolean fCheckPreviousShutdownDate

fSilentActivation

protected boolean fSilentActivation

fUseStrippedActivationKeyChars

protected boolean fUseStrippedActivationKeyChars

fAcceptLicenseAgreement

protected boolean fAcceptLicenseAgreement

fMaintainPreviousShutdownDate

protected boolean fMaintainPreviousShutdownDate

fActivationLockOptions

protected int fActivationLockOptions

fSecretStorageProviders

protected SecretStorage.Provider[] fSecretStorageProviders

fFacadeConnectionConfigs

protected FacadeConnectionConfig[] fFacadeConnectionConfigs

fLicensingServerConnectionConfigs

protected LicensingServerConnectionConfig[] fLicensingServerConnectionConfigs

fLicensingWizardLogo

protected java.lang.String fLicensingWizardLogo

fLicensingWizardLogoRes

protected java.lang.String fLicensingWizardLogoRes

fLicensingWizardOptions

protected int fLicensingWizardOptions

fActivationWizardLogo

protected java.lang.String fActivationWizardLogo

fActivationWizardLogoRes

protected java.lang.String fActivationWizardLogoRes

fActivationWizardOptions

protected int fActivationWizardOptions

fDeactivationWizardLogo

protected java.lang.String fDeactivationWizardLogo

fDeactivationWizardLogoRes

protected java.lang.String fDeactivationWizardLogoRes

fDeactivationWizardOptions

protected int fDeactivationWizardOptions

fLicenseLockWizardLogo

protected java.lang.String fLicenseLockWizardLogo

fLicenseLockWizardLogoRes

protected java.lang.String fLicenseLockWizardLogoRes

fLicenseLockWizardOptions

protected int fLicenseLockWizardOptions
Constructor Detail

ProtectionLauncherConfigBase

public ProtectionLauncherConfigBase()
Method Detail

isAllowFlexibleExpirationDate

public boolean isAllowFlexibleExpirationDate()

setAllowFlexibleExpirationDate

public void setAllowFlexibleExpirationDate(boolean aAllowFlexibleExpirationDate)

isCheckPreviousShutdownDate

public boolean isCheckPreviousShutdownDate()

setCheckPreviousShutdownDate

public void setCheckPreviousShutdownDate(boolean aCheckPreviousShutdownDate)

isSilentActivation

public boolean isSilentActivation()

setSilentActivation

public void setSilentActivation(boolean aSilentActivation)

isUseStrippedActivationKeyChars

public boolean isUseStrippedActivationKeyChars()

setUseStrippedActivationKeyChars

public void setUseStrippedActivationKeyChars(boolean aUseStrippedActivationKeyChars)

isGUI

public boolean isGUI()

setGUI

public void setGUI(boolean aGUI)

getLicenseTextCommercial

public java.lang.String getLicenseTextCommercial()

setLicenseTextCommercial

public void setLicenseTextCommercial(java.lang.String aLicenseTextCommercial)

getLicenseTextEvaluation

public java.lang.String getLicenseTextEvaluation()

setLicenseTextEvaluation

public void setLicenseTextEvaluation(java.lang.String aLicenseTextEvaluation)

getLicenseFileName

public java.lang.String getLicenseFileName()

setLicenseFileName

public void setLicenseFileName(java.lang.String aLicenseFileName)

getLicenseFolder

public java.lang.String getLicenseFolder()

setLicenseFolder

public void setLicenseFolder(java.lang.String aLicenseFolder)

getLicenseResourceFolder

public java.lang.String getLicenseResourceFolder()

setLicenseResourceFolder

public void setLicenseResourceFolder(java.lang.String aLicenseResourceFolder)

isLicenseUserHomeRelative

public boolean isLicenseUserHomeRelative()

setLicenseUserHomeRelative

public void setLicenseUserHomeRelative(boolean aLicenseUserHomeRelative)

getSecretStorageProviders

public SecretStorage.Provider[] getSecretStorageProviders()

setSecretStorageProviders

public void setSecretStorageProviders(SecretStorage.Provider[] aSecretStorageProviders)

getFacadeConnectionConfigs

public FacadeConnectionConfig[] getFacadeConnectionConfigs()

setFacadeConnectionConfigs

public void setFacadeConnectionConfigs(FacadeConnectionConfig[] aFacadeConnectionConfigs)

getLicensingServerConnectionConfigs

public LicensingServerConnectionConfig[] getLicensingServerConnectionConfigs()

setLicensingServerConnectionConfigs

public void setLicensingServerConnectionConfigs(LicensingServerConnectionConfig[] aLicensingServerConnectionConfigs)

getActivationLockOptions

public int getActivationLockOptions()
To Do:
uncomment for launcher use

getActivationLockOptionsStr

public java.lang.String getActivationLockOptionsStr()

setActivationLockOptions

public void setActivationLockOptions(int aActivationLockOptions)

clone

public java.lang.Object clone()
Overrides:
clone in class java.lang.Object

getLicensingWizardOptions

public int getLicensingWizardOptions()

getLicensingWizardOptionsStr

public java.lang.String getLicensingWizardOptionsStr()

setLicensingWizardOptions

public void setLicensingWizardOptions(int anOptions)

getLicensingWizardLogo

public java.lang.String getLicensingWizardLogo()

setLicensingWizardLogo

public void setLicensingWizardLogo(java.lang.String aLicensingWizardLogo)

getActivationWizardLogo

public java.lang.String getActivationWizardLogo()

setActivationWizardLogo

public void setActivationWizardLogo(java.lang.String aActivationWizardLogo)

getActivationWizardOptions

public int getActivationWizardOptions()

getActivationWizardOptionsStr

public java.lang.String getActivationWizardOptionsStr()

setActivationWizardOptions

public void setActivationWizardOptions(int aActivationWizardOptions)

getLicenseLockWizardLogo

public java.lang.String getLicenseLockWizardLogo()

setLicenseLockWizardLogo

public void setLicenseLockWizardLogo(java.lang.String aLicenseLockWizardLogo)

getLicenseLockWizardLogoRes

public java.lang.String getLicenseLockWizardLogoRes()

setLicenseLockWizardLogoRes

public void setLicenseLockWizardLogoRes(java.lang.String aLicenseLockWizardLogoRes)

getLicenseLockWizardOptions

public int getLicenseLockWizardOptions()

setLicenseLockWizardOptions

public void setLicenseLockWizardOptions(int aLicenseLockWizardOptions)

getLicenseLockWizardOptionsStr

public java.lang.String getLicenseLockWizardOptionsStr()

isAcceptLicenseAgreement

public boolean isAcceptLicenseAgreement()

setAcceptLicenseAgreement

public void setAcceptLicenseAgreement(boolean aAcceptLicenseAgreement)

getCopyright

public java.lang.String getCopyright()

setCopyright

public void setCopyright(java.lang.String aCopyright)

getCompany

public java.lang.String getCompany()

setCompany

public void setCompany(java.lang.String aCompany)

getLicenseTextCommercialRes

public java.lang.String getLicenseTextCommercialRes()

setLicenseTextCommercialRes

public void setLicenseTextCommercialRes(java.lang.String aLicenseTextCommercialRes)

getLicenseTextEvaluationRes

public java.lang.String getLicenseTextEvaluationRes()

setLicenseTextEvaluationRes

public void setLicenseTextEvaluationRes(java.lang.String aLicenseTextEvaluationRes)

getLicensingWizardLogoRes

public java.lang.String getLicensingWizardLogoRes()

setLicensingWizardLogoRes

public void setLicensingWizardLogoRes(java.lang.String aLicensingWizardLogoRes)

getActivationWizardLogoRes

public java.lang.String getActivationWizardLogoRes()

setActivationWizardLogoRes

public void setActivationWizardLogoRes(java.lang.String aActivationWizardLogoRes)

getCompanyLogo

public java.lang.String getCompanyLogo()

setCompanyLogo

public void setCompanyLogo(java.lang.String aCompanyLogo)

getCompanyLogoRes

public java.lang.String getCompanyLogoRes()

setCompanyLogoRes

public void setCompanyLogoRes(java.lang.String aCompanyLogoRes)

getDeactivationWizardLogo

public java.lang.String getDeactivationWizardLogo()

setDeactivationWizardLogo

public void setDeactivationWizardLogo(java.lang.String aDeactivationWizardLogo)

getDeactivationWizardLogoRes

public java.lang.String getDeactivationWizardLogoRes()

setDeactivationWizardLogoRes

public void setDeactivationWizardLogoRes(java.lang.String aDeactivationWizardLogoRes)

getDeactivationWizardOptions

public int getDeactivationWizardOptions()

getDeactivationWizardOptionsStr

public java.lang.String getDeactivationWizardOptionsStr()

setDeactivationWizardOptions

public void setDeactivationWizardOptions(int aDeactivationWizardOptions)

isMaintainPreviousShutdownDate

public boolean isMaintainPreviousShutdownDate()

setMaintainPreviousShutdownDate

public void setMaintainPreviousShutdownDate(boolean aMaintainPreviousShutdownDate)

getPrevLicenseLocations

public java.util.List<LicenseLocation> getPrevLicenseLocations()

getLicensingServerStatusURL

public java.lang.String getLicensingServerStatusURL()

setLicensingServerStatusURL

public void setLicensingServerStatusURL(java.lang.String aLicensingServerStatusURL)